Abstract

Abstract: A new cobalt(II) coordination polymer, namely [Co0.5

(bimb)1.5]n·nClO4 (bimb =1,4-bis(imidazol-1-yl)-butane)  (1), has

been prepared and fully characterized by single-crystal X-ray

diffraction, elemental analyses, IR spectroscopy and X-ray powder

diffraction pattern analysis (PXRD). Of the compound, the

Co(II) center is octahedral coordinated with bimb serving as a

bridging ligand by employing six N-donor to coordinate with

the Co(II) center. It exbihits three-dimensional network structure

via bimb ligands.
